[PHP] Callbacks in XML Parser
Hi, Is there a way in PHP5 where I can use the xml_parser's xml_set_element_handler() inside a class definition like so: xml_set_element_handler($this-xmlParser, $this-startTag, $this-endTag); For me, this code doesn't seem to work.
